Output ec26c05b7a573e35224adaafa3b95d53a25dc3518883e50a99aa2cb6cf5f3481:0

value
1595909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a213dc51ac20342b36e69c68aa896db5c7ccd076 OP_EQUALVERIFY OP_CHECKSIG
address
1FmzG1y7wYfdKnq6EEpgDzRCeRrPVD7JU2
transaction
ec26c05b7a573e35224adaafa3b95d53a25dc3518883e50a99aa2cb6cf5f3481
spent
true